520 | _aSupported by her father's money, Alison Poole lives on New York's Upper East Side, spending her days visiting the tanning salon, inhaling cocaine and searching for true love--until life in the fast lane spins out of control! The long-awaited new novel from the author of Bright Lights, Big City. | ||
